International Art Workshop Pienkow 2008
The seventh International Art Workshop Pienkow2008, took place in Pienkow from June 28 till July 11, 2008. The Art Advisory Committee reviewed a large number of portfolios of alumni from renown art centers and awarded participation in our workshop to the following artists:
Wiktor Dyndo, Arkdiusz Karapuda, Maria Rostocka, Izabela Wadolowska and Iwona Zawadzka from the Academy of Fine Arts in Warsaw;
Tetiana Kashkarova, Artem Kopaygorenko and Maryna Orlova from the
Academy of Fine Arts in Kiev.
Our artists were accommodated at Ucher House of Artists and assisted by our director, Mrs. Teresa Chomik.

A special event of this years Workshop was the opening of the exhibition of painting of Professor Stanislaw Baj, entitled "The Mother" in the Museum of Chelm, on the first day of the meeting. Professor Baj has brought his exhibition to an unusual and exceptional place, a former unitary-orthodox church, which enhanced the impact of his art.

According to our tradition, laureate of last year's workshop, Tomasz Kalitko presented his art at Galeria 72, Chelm generating much interest in our artistic community. His paintings follow the concept of the "new figuration" of Professor Jan Switka, his master. Paintings of Kalitko contain an enormous load of emotion drawn from experiencing the todays world. Along with Kalitko, another exhibition of graphic art of Professor Przemyslaw Tyszkiewicz - Head of Graphic Art Department at the Academy of Fine Arts in Wroclaw - has been presented. His works are produced using the aquaforta and aquatinta technique and draw attention by its unrealistic, fairy tale scenery and style.

We concluded the workshop with an exhibition of art evaluated by our Artistic Advisory Committee:
Professor Baj from Academy of Fine Arts, Warsaw; Mr, Kazarian, artist; Tomasz Kalitko, winner of 2007 edition of the workshop; Professor Jan van der Pol from The Royal Academy at Hague; Professor Piotr Kielan from Wroclaw; and Dr. Marek Maria Pienkowski.

The jury selected Arkadiusz Karapuda from Warsaw as a winner of the competition.

The 7th Pienkow International Art Workshop 2008 concluded with a fine gala at Dr. Pienkowski's residence Pienkow, which brought a variety of artists, local business elite and politicians.
